Interior


Here you can see the main part of the cockpit. Nothing fancy but it helps me keep an eye on what is going on. From left to right we have the fuel gauge, below that is the unhooked temp gauge, in the center left position is the 8k tach, center right is the speedometer. Next on the right is the oil pressure and amp meter. On the far right is the aftermarket Stewart/Warner oil pressure and temp gauges.


SPECIFICATIONS

* Stock red dash / door panels
* Replaced tach w/ 8,000 rpm unit from Turbo 4-cylinder car
* Center console from '85 Mustang
* Power assisted seats from '89 GT (red tweed)
* All underlay and sound deadener deleted
* Dead pedal from '89 GT
* Stewart Warner oil pressure and temperature gauges
